The 9 streets are transverse streets that connect the Heren-, Keizers-, and Prinsengracht ( 3 x 3 = 9 Straatjes ). It was built at the end of the Golden Age because the old city area did not offer sufficient space for all activities. In the 9 streets it was literally bursting with trade, craft & culture and in 2010 this is still noticeable. The name of Amsterdam's Negen Straatjes district translates as the 'nine little streets'. Chic and central, the area is home to some of the Dutch capital's smartest boutiques and is dotted with stylish cafes and hotels. The Negen Straatjes was recognised officially as one of the Amsterdam's districts in 1997.

Known to locals as De Negen Straatjes (Nine Streets), this area is known for its boutiques and speciality stores selling everything from upscaled vintage accessories to retro furniture. The area is also home to a wealth of foodie hotspots, fascinating monuments and stately canal house museums. Visit the city's first photography museum Built near the end of the city's Golden age, the district does consist of nine streets in Amsterdam, which include: Berenstraat Gasthuismolensteeg Huidenstraat Hartenstraat Oude Spiegelstraat Runstraat Reestraat Wijde Heisteeg Wolvenstraat The nine streets included in the Negen Straatjes are Reestraat, Hartenstraat, Gasthuismolensteeg, Berenstraat, Wolvenstraat, Spielgelstraat, Runstraat, Huidenstraat, and Wijde Heisteeg. These streets are partially for the trades that once happened here (e.g. animal skinning). Amsterdam's nine streets are at the heart of boutique shopping in Amsterdam. The streets are filled with local designers, one-off cafes, vintage thrift stores and small concept stores. The most trendy shopping area of Amsterdam is located within nine little streets of the Old Town, called The Nine Small Streets or The Nine Little Streets (Dutch: De 9 Straatjes). The 9 Small Streets are actually three streets crossing two canals: Herengracht a Keizersgracht, which makes up for nine small streets. The 9 Streets were created way back in the 17th century, and today they are part of the UNESCO World Heritage List. The canals are Prinsengracht, Singel, Herengracht and Keizersgracht and they are connected by smaller side streets packed with lots of businesses and shops.
